Kawasaki City Museum is a well-known museum located in Kawasaki, Japan. Dedicated to preserving the rich history and heritage of the city, the museum is home to a vast collection of art and artifacts that showcase the culture of the region. The museum's exhibits cover a range of topics, including local history, arts, crafts, and technology, providing visitors with a comprehensive view of Kawasaki's past and present.
